|
Mitloggen der Fehllogins
|
| Panter |
Geschrieben am 19. März 2010 22:20:10
|
Stammgast

Posts: 120
Registriert seit: 03.02.09
Erfahrener BenutzerNächstes Level: 120/250 Scores: gesperrt
Verwarnstatus:    
|
Mytelion schrieb:
Hmm da kommt aber der Gleiche fehler
Fehler
Code Parse error: parse error, expecting `','' or `';'' in S:\xampp\htdocs\administration\panel_editor.php(128) : eval()'d code on line 2
und so schaut das im panel aus
Code openside("name");
echo "dbquery("ALTER TABLE ".DB_USERS." ADD user_faillogin SMALLINT( 2 ) UNSIGNED NOT NULL");
closeside();
Der fehler liegt hier
und so schaut das im panel aus
Code openside("name");
echo "dbquery("ALTER TABLE ".DB_USERS." ADD user_faillogin SMALLINT( 2 ) UNSIGNED NOT NULL");
closeside();
Versuch es mal so in den Panel zu machen.
Name es Panels ist vollkommen egal und beim Panel inhalt machst du nur das hier rein
Code dbquery("ALTER TABLE ".DB_USERS." ADD user_faillogin SMALLINT( 2 ) UNSIGNED NOT NULL");
sonst nix im inhalt...
lg. Panter
Mein Rechner:
AMD Athlon 2 X4 630
4 GB Ram
NIVIDIA GeForce 9500 GT 1024 MB
8 TB Festplatten Speicher
Und nein ich bin kein Zokker so was ist luxus  |
 |
|
|
|
|
| Mytelion |
Geschrieben am 19. März 2010 22:43:20
|
Stammgast

Posts: 100
Registriert seit: 03.01.10
Erfahrener BenutzerNächstes Level: 100/250 Scores: gesperrt
Verwarnstatus:    
|
Ich hatte ja mein BT noch mal bearbeitet und dort rein geschrieben das er es über den Panel jetzt die db eingetragen hat aber ich bekomme keine nachricht wen ich jetzt password oder Name falsh eingebe!sonst ist jetzt alles richtig hir noch mal meine user info panel Komplet.
EDIT: Code entfernt, zu lang ! Wozu kann man Anhänge machen?!
>>>Ich habe keine schreibfehler ich denke nur zu schnell ^^<<< |
 |
|
|
|
|
| emblinux |
Geschrieben am 20. März 2010 08:14:31
|


Posts: 3664
Registriert seit: 04.10.08
MeisterNächstes Level: 3686/5000 Scores: gesperrt
|
Dann prüfe doch mal nach, ob das Tabellenfeld auch wirklich angelegt wurde.
Das Lernen ist wie ein Meer ohne Ufer. Konfuzius
Alles wird Gut!
KEIN Support per Mail, ICQ oder PN !
 |
 |
|
|
|
|
| Mytelion |
Geschrieben am 20. März 2010 12:59:15
|
Stammgast

Posts: 100
Registriert seit: 03.01.10
Erfahrener BenutzerNächstes Level: 100/250 Scores: gesperrt
Verwarnstatus:    
|
Wo packt er das tabellen feld den eigendlich hin bei der DB?
Ach ja ich nutzte Navicat!
PS: mir ist gerade auf gefallen wen ich im admin bereich bin dann zeigt er mir diesen Fehler an in der User info panel
Code
Notice: Undefined index: user_faillogin in S:\xampp\htdocs\infusions\user_info_panel\user_info_panel.php on line 53
in dieser zeile ist dann wie mann es auch sehen kann das Script worum es hir ja die gantze zeit geht!
kann es sein das ich es woanders setzt muß in der user info panel von MarkusG???
Editiert von Mytelion am 20. März 2010 13:04:47
>>>Ich habe keine schreibfehler ich denke nur zu schnell ^^<<< |
 |
|
|
|
|
| emblinux |
Geschrieben am 20. März 2010 13:21:23
|


Posts: 3664
Registriert seit: 04.10.08
MeisterNächstes Level: 3686/5000 Scores: gesperrt
|
Diese Meldung bestätigt mir nur meine Vermutung, dass das Tabellenfeld nicht angelegt wurde.
Benutze einfach phpMyAdmin oder ein anderes Administrationstool, womit du deine Datenbank administrieren kannst und lege das Feld manuell an. Die Tabelle, in die das Feld rein muss, lautet fusion_users oder so ähnlich, kommt auf dein Prefix an.
Oder mach einfach nochmal den Schritt mit dem Panel, wo das Feld angelegt wird.
Das Lernen ist wie ein Meer ohne Ufer. Konfuzius
Alles wird Gut!
KEIN Support per Mail, ICQ oder PN !
 |
 |
|
|
|
|
| Mytelion |
Geschrieben am 21. März 2010 16:59:09
|
Stammgast

Posts: 100
Registriert seit: 03.01.10
Erfahrener BenutzerNächstes Level: 100/250 Scores: gesperrt
Verwarnstatus:    
|
So ich habe jetzt PHPmyadmin Gestartet da ich noch nie damit gearbeitet habe
sonder nur mit Navicat Breute ich ein wenig hilfe für die hilfe einees Tabellen eintrages!
>>>Ich habe keine schreibfehler ich denke nur zu schnell ^^<<< |
 |
|
|
|
|
| MarcusG |
Geschrieben am 21. März 2010 20:01:03
|


Posts: 2936
Registriert seit: 21.01.09
MeisterNächstes Level: 2942/5000 Scores: gesperrt
|
http://www.phpmya...e/docs.php
Gruß Marcus
Support per Mail, PN, ICQ oder MSN ist kostenpflichtig!
if ($ahnung == 'keine' ) { use ( FAQ ) && ( Google | | Suche ) }
if ($antwort == 0 ) { post ( Frage ) } |
 |
|
|
|
|
| Mytelion |
Geschrieben am 21. März 2010 21:28:57
|
Stammgast

Posts: 100
Registriert seit: 03.01.10
Erfahrener BenutzerNächstes Level: 100/250 Scores: gesperrt
Verwarnstatus:    
|
So ich habe jetzt die DB eintrag drinne aber es geht immer noch nicht,langsam glaube ich das es am user info panel vom MarcusG liegt,da er mir ja auch den fehler anzeigt
Code Notice: Undefined index: user_faillogin in S:\xampp\htdocs\infusions\user_info_panel\user_info_panel.php on line 53
wen ich im Admin menü binn!also in admin und dann links das user info Panel.
>>>Ich habe keine schreibfehler ich denke nur zu schnell ^^<<< |
 |
|
|
|
|
| emblinux |
Geschrieben am 22. März 2010 07:40:14
|


Posts: 3664
Registriert seit: 04.10.08
MeisterNächstes Level: 3686/5000 Scores: gesperrt
|
Diese Meldung deutet eigentlich nur darauf, dass das Feld immer noch nicht in der entsprechenden Tabelle vorhanden ist. Eventuell hast du es in der falschen Tabelle angelegt oder falsch geschrieben.
Das Lernen ist wie ein Meer ohne Ufer. Konfuzius
Alles wird Gut!
KEIN Support per Mail, ICQ oder PN !
 |
 |
|
|
|
|
| Mytelion |
Geschrieben am 22. März 2010 13:29:22
|
Stammgast

Posts: 100
Registriert seit: 03.01.10
Erfahrener BenutzerNächstes Level: 100/250 Scores: gesperrt
Verwarnstatus:    
|
So fangen wir noch ein mal an die Tabelle soll in die usesr db rein richtig?
Ich gehe so vor PHPmyadmin/portal=meine DB/tabelle users/
dann dann gehe ich oben auf Struktur und Srolle runter bis zu den Feld
Felder hinzufügen dort gebe ich 2 an und komme auf ne neue seite
wo ich diese sachen machen kann
Feld
Typ
Länge/Set1
Standard2
Kollation
Attribute
Null
Index
Kommentare
MIME-Typ
Darstellungsumwandlung
Umwandlungsoptionen3
Und dort gebe ich dann die Endsprechendn daten ein
Feld=mittoggen/oder SMALLINT
Typ=SMALLINT
Länge/Set1=2
Standard2
Kollation
Attribute=UNSIGNED
Null
Index
Kommentare
MIME-Typ
Darstellungsumwandlung
Umwandlungsoptionen3
dann nur noch auf Speichern und Fertig Drinne ist er aber immer noch nix.
solte ich was Falsch gemacht haben?! kann mir einer bitte diese tabelle posten dann Importiere ich das?
Ich habe kaum ahnung von PHPmy admin ich mache sonst alles Über Navicat.
>>>Ich habe keine schreibfehler ich denke nur zu schnell ^^<<< |
 |
|
|
|
|
| emblinux |
Geschrieben am 22. März 2010 13:55:31
|


Posts: 3664
Registriert seit: 04.10.08
MeisterNächstes Level: 3686/5000 Scores: gesperrt
|
Alles falsch !
Versuche es bitte einfach nochmal richtig mit dem Panel, wo du den Code für das Einfügen reinmachst und auf vorschau gehst. Ganz wichtig, Panelname/titel und Admin-Passwort
Wenn du es über phpMyAdmin machen möchtest, musst du wie folgt vorgehen:
- Auf Datenbank gehen
- auf Tabelle fusion_users gehen
- lass dir die Struktur dieser Tabelle anzeigen und gehe dann unten auf Feldhinzufügen, jedoch reicht ein Feld.
- Name des Feldes: user_faillogin; Typ SMALLINT; Länge: 1; Attribute: UNSIGNED; der rest ist egal und dann auf speichern.
- jetzt sollte ein Feld mit dem Namen user_faillogin hinzugefügt worden sein.
Wenn dir das alles zu hoch ist, dann lass bitte einfach die Finger davon.
Das Lernen ist wie ein Meer ohne Ufer. Konfuzius
Alles wird Gut!
KEIN Support per Mail, ICQ oder PN !
 |
 |
|
|
|
|
| Mytelion |
Geschrieben am 22. März 2010 14:01:10
|
Stammgast

Posts: 100
Registriert seit: 03.01.10
Erfahrener BenutzerNächstes Level: 100/250 Scores: gesperrt
Verwarnstatus:    
|
Ich hatte darmals bei der instalation den Prefix namen fusion_geändert in avsh das heist das die tabelle dann bei mir so ausschaut avshusers
ist das dann richtig die Tabelle ich Teste mal.
>>>EDIT es geht aber es ist Komisch weil so habe ich es vorher auch in der PHPmyadmin gemacht liegt es an den feld namen user_faillogin vieleicht? XD danke euch allen FREU.<<<
Editiert von Mytelion am 22. März 2010 14:05:23
>>>Ich habe keine schreibfehler ich denke nur zu schnell ^^<<< |
 |
|
|
|
|
| emblinux |
Geschrieben am 22. März 2010 14:10:33
|


Posts: 3664
Registriert seit: 04.10.08
MeisterNächstes Level: 3686/5000 Scores: gesperrt
|
Wenn dein Prefix ein anderes ist, dann heißt deine Tabelle natürlich anders, das habe ich aber auch schon zuvor erwähnt, das man darauf achten muss.
Und es ist schon wichtig, wie der Name des Tabellenfeldes ist, denn so wird ja auf ihn drauf zugegriffen. Wenn du einen anderen namens benutzt, dann musst du es an den entsprechenden Stellen auch so abändern. Deshalb sage ich auch immer, das man sich die Anleitung in Ruhe und genau durchlesen soll. Ein solcher Mod setzt jedoch schon eine gewisse Grundkenntnis im Bereich PHP und MySql vorraus. Jemand der keine Ahnung davon hat, sollte von solchen Mods tunlichst die Finger lassen und sich erst mal mit der ganzen Materie beschäftigen.
Das Lernen ist wie ein Meer ohne Ufer. Konfuzius
Alles wird Gut!
KEIN Support per Mail, ICQ oder PN !
 |
 |
|
|
|
|
| Iwan |
Geschrieben am 25. März 2010 12:38:41
|
Anfänger

Posts: 12
Registriert seit: 25.03.10
AmateurNächstes Level: 12/25 Scores: gesperrt
Verwarnstatus:    
|
Hallo zusammen,
ich bin der neue und habe den "Mod" bei mir erfolgreich integriert 
Leider hab ich keine Ahnung von PHP, aber kann man den Code so erweitern, das man:
- nach dem 3. falschen Login einen dicken fetten Hinweis sieht, das man nur noch 2 Versuche hat und am besten sein Passwort erfragen bzw. einen Admin kontaktieren sollte
- mit dem 5. falschen Login der Account gesperrt wird
Ich vermute mal, das es in der setuser.php integriert werden muss, aber leider habe ich keine Ahnung wie 
Wahrscheinlich ist es nur eine Frage des Zeitaufwandes, gell?
Editiert von Iwan am 25. März 2010 12:42:34 |
 |
|
|
|
|
| Iwan |
Geschrieben am 27. März 2010 13:05:17
|
Anfänger

Posts: 12
Registriert seit: 25.03.10
AmateurNächstes Level: 12/25 Scores: gesperrt
Verwarnstatus:    
|
ist die Integration so schwer und zeitaufwändig oder möchte keiner helfen? |
 |
|
|
|
|
| Kevin |
Geschrieben am 27. März 2010 14:29:58
|

Stammgast

Posts: 193
Registriert seit: 06.10.08
Erfahrener BenutzerNächstes Level: 195/250 Scores: gesperrt
Verwarnstatus:    
|
Hallo Iwan,
ich hätte da eine möglichkeit. Dafür gibt es ein Infusion das nennt sich "Bad Login" da wird der User automatisch nach 10 falschen Logins gesperrt und kann die Seite dann nicht mehr erreichen.
Weiss nicht ob es das ist was du suchst 
LG Kevin |
 |
|
|
|
|
| Iwan |
Geschrieben am 29. März 2010 10:03:08
|
Anfänger

Posts: 12
Registriert seit: 25.03.10
AmateurNächstes Level: 12/25 Scores: gesperrt
Verwarnstatus:    
|
Das klingt doch gut.
Wichtig für mich ist einfach, das "böse" nicht ewig Passwörter ausprobieren können. |
 |
|
|
|
|
| Kevin |
Geschrieben am 29. März 2010 16:25:58
|

Stammgast

Posts: 193
Registriert seit: 06.10.08
Erfahrener BenutzerNächstes Level: 195/250 Scores: gesperrt
Verwarnstatus:    
|
Ja also das funktioniert soweit dann auch. Also wenn der User 10 mal sich mit einem falschen Nick einlockt wird er gesperrt.
Die 10 kannst du aber im Code ab ändern.
Wenn der User sich dann bei dir meldet, musste ihn aus der Blacklist raus nehmen da er dort automatisch rein geschrieben wird.
Zu beachten ist das wenn der User auf der Blacklist steht er auf eine bestimmte Seite weitergeleitet wird müsste google sein. Das findest du aber in der maincore da kannste das auch ab ändern und an deine wunsch URL weiter leiten.
Das Bad Login System hab ich von der phpfusion-mods.net Seite. So als Tipp 
LG Kevin
Editiert von Kevin am 29. März 2010 16:27:27 |
 |
|
|
|
|
| Iwan |
Geschrieben am 29. März 2010 23:20:40
|
Anfänger

Posts: 12
Registriert seit: 25.03.10
AmateurNächstes Level: 12/25 Scores: gesperrt
Verwarnstatus:    
|
Danke für den Tip. Ich nehme mal an, es ist der "Bad Login Manager", oder?
oh man... "Warning: Only registered users can download infusions and modifications!"
und wieder wieder eine Registrierung mehr
Editiert von Iwan am 29. März 2010 23:22:01 |
 |
|
|
|
|
| Kevin |
Geschrieben am 30. März 2010 14:20:11
|

Stammgast

Posts: 193
Registriert seit: 06.10.08
Erfahrener BenutzerNächstes Level: 195/250 Scores: gesperrt
Verwarnstatus:    
|
Ja Iwan das ist das richtige Und kein thema gern geschehen 
ja wenn du das teil haben willst musst du dich regestrieren.
Das ding ist es aber wirklich wert und du bekommst dort eine menge nützliche Infusions und Mods auch wenn diese in Englisch sind kann man ja umschreiben 
LG Kevin |
 |
|